Overview of the Energy and Power Generation Sector in the United States

The energy and power generation sector in the United States is a vast and complex network that encompasses a wide array of energy sources and technologies. As of the latest data, the country boasts a total of 10,175 power plants, contributing to an impressive total installed capacity of 1,421.8 gigawatts (GW). This extensive infrastructure supports the energy needs of a diverse economy and a population exceeding 330 million people, making it one of the largest and most developed energy systems in the world.

The primary energy sources in the United States are varied, with natural gas leading the way. There are 1,881 natural gas plants, which collectively provide a staggering 575.0 GW of installed capacity. This dominance is primarily due to the recent shale gas boom, which has made natural gas a more accessible and economically viable option for power generation. Following natural gas, hydroelectric power plays a significant role, with 1,491 plants contributing 110.2 GW. Despite being one of the oldest forms of renewable energy, hydro remains a crucial part of the energy mix, particularly in states with abundant water resources.

Renewable energy has made remarkable strides in recent years, showcasing the United States' commitment to transitioning towards cleaner energy sources. Solar power has seen exponential growth, with 3,293 solar plants totaling 38.2 GW of capacity. This surge is driven by falling costs, technological advancements, and supportive policies at both federal and state levels. Wind energy is also a significant contributor, with 1,141 wind plants generating 105.9 GW. The development of wind farms, particularly in the Great Plains and offshore, has positioned wind as one of the fastest-growing sectors in renewable energy.

Despite the progress in renewable energy, the sector faces several challenges. One of the major obstacles is the intermittent nature of renewable power sources like solar and wind, which can lead to reliability issues in energy supply. Additionally, the current infrastructure may require significant upgrades to accommodate the increasing share of renewables in the energy mix. The regulatory environment can also pose challenges, as different states have varying policies and incentives that can impact the pace of energy transition.
